Mission

ØTo be the Navy’s Principal Research,Development, Test, Evaluation, Engineering,and Fleet Support Activity for:ÄNaval Aircraft

ÄEngines

ÄAvionics

ÄAircraft Support Systems

ÄShip/Shore Air Operations

PAX Aircraft DivisionWorkforce

As of 30 Sept 1999

Military1,258 (12%)

Civilians 4152 (39%)Contractors 5,338 (49%)

TOTAL: 10,748
